Joel was born and raised in Aberdeen, Idaho and educated at the University of Utah (’98) with a degree in Communication with a Minor in Spanish. Upon graduating from the University of Idaho College of Law (’02), he returned home to Southeast Idaho. His respected career has enabled him to serve on the Idaho Trial Lawyers Association board of directors, Sixth District Magistrate Commission for Idaho State Bar and the American Falls School Board. He was recognized in the National Trial Lawyers Top 100 Civil Plaintiff Trial Lawyers in Idaho.
In addition to being a husband and father of four, Joel speaks fluent Spanish and loves hunting, fly fishing, reading, attending sporting events and dabbles in Drone Photography. He also has extensive experience with nonprofit board service.
